Inscription / Connexion Nouveau Sujet
Niveau énigmes
Partager :

Saut de puce savante

Posté par
Vassillia
17-11-22 à 20:59

Bonjour, je vous propose de m'aider à monter un numéro de cirque avec une puce que j'ai dressée (ne me demandez pas comment je fais, c'est un secret professionnel).

Je la place au centre d'un disque de rayon 20cm et elle doit trouver une goutte de sang placée n'importe où dans ce disque.
La puce se déplace en faisant des sauts de 10cm et lorsqu'elle est à un endroit elle a un champ de vision qui correspond à un disque centré sur elle et de rayon 10cm.

A chaque saut, je pourrais lui donner l'information : tu te rapproches, tu l'éloignes ou la distance ne varie pas par rapport à l'objectif.

En combien de saut minimum, cette puce savante peut-elle être assurée de se nourrir ? Quelle stratégie me conseillez vous de lui apprendre au préalable pour réussir cet exploit ?

Posté par
dpi
re : Saut de puce savante 18-11-22 à 08:32

Bonjour,
Je pense que le premier saut est effectué sans conseil ...

 Cliquez pour afficher

Posté par
carpediem
re : Saut de puce savante 18-11-22 à 09:21

salut

en utilisant des dm on en revient à des unités ... ce qui est plus simple et normalisé ... (et pratique avec ggb pour visualiser à l'aide d'une figure )

soit C le disque de centre O et de rayon 2 rapporté au repère orthonormé de centre O
soit D le disque de centre P et rayon 1 (donc P = puce !!)
notons S le point correspondant à la goutte de sang

on note P et Q deux positions consécutives de la puce

premier saut : P en (1, 0)

 Cliquez pour afficher


tout le pb est ensuite d'adapter la valeur des angles a et b pour affiner au fur et à mesure du nombre de sauts et des informations arrivant au compte goutte (de sang !! )

Posté par
Vassillia
re : Saut de puce savante 18-11-22 à 11:22

Tu as compris le principe dpi mais on cherche dans un disque, pas seulement sur un axe donc c'est plus compliqué que ça.
C'est l'idée carpediem, il faut trouver les bons angles, il n'y a plus qu'à faire des jolis dessins pour montrer que les disques correspondants aux champs de vision successifs de la puce recouvrent toutes la zone possible pour la goutte de sang en fonction des informations obtenues

Posté par
derny
re : Saut de puce savante 18-11-22 à 14:30

Bonjour
On s'éloigne ou on se rapproche. La distance identique est, pour ainsi dire impossible (1 cas sur l'infini).
Je ferais le premier saut à 10cm (le max possible) "n'importe où". Ensuite je trace la médiatrice de ces 2 premières positions. Suivant l'indication, + près ou+ loin, on est d'1 côté ou de l'autre de cette médiatrice.
... à suivre ...

Posté par
Cpierre60
re : Saut de puce savante 18-11-22 à 17:57

Bonjour;

Citation :
La puce se déplace en faisant des sauts de 10cm

Doit-on comprendre "des sauts qui font toujours 10 cm ?"
Merci

Posté par
Vassillia
re : Saut de puce savante 18-11-22 à 18:27

Exactement, toujours exactement 10cm mais dans la direction qui lui parait la plus pertinente au vu des informations qu'elle a.

Posté par
jarod128
re : Saut de puce savante 18-11-22 à 22:43

Bonjour. La goutte de sang est elle considérée comme un point ou un disque de rayon donné?

Posté par
Vassillia
re : Saut de puce savante 19-11-22 à 11:02

Un point

Posté par
derny
re : Saut de puce savante 19-11-22 à 12:44

Bonjour
Vassillia, la puce doit, au final, trouver la goutte dans son champ de vision et non tomber juste dessus ce qui serait impossible à mon avis ? C'est une question.

Posté par
Imod
re : Saut de puce savante 19-11-22 à 12:49

Bonjour

Il me semble que dès que la tache apparait dans le champ de vision , deux sauts suffisent pour conclure .

Imod

Posté par
ty59847
re : Saut de puce savante 19-11-22 à 13:13

Si on ne dit rien à la puce, en faisant un parcours avec des angles droits (0,0)(10,0)(10,10)(0,10) ... elle a l'assurance de voir la cible en 8 sauts max, et d'atteindre la cible en 18 sauts max.
Avec les informations (s'éloigne ou se rapproche), on va viser mieux.

Au départ, la puce est en A(0,0)
Si elle voit la cible... c'est quasi fini.
Elle saute en B(10,0).
Si elle voit la cible... c'est quasi fini.
Si on lui dit qu'elle se rapproche de la cible, ça s'engage bien. Non seulement le terrain qui reste à explorer est petit(6 ou 8 fois plus petit que dans l'autre scénario), mais en plus, la puce est plus ou moins à proximité de la cible.
On va donc explorer uniquement les cas où on lui dit qu'elle s'éloigne de la cible.
Elle saute en C(2,6) ou à peu près.
Si quand elle arrive en C, on lui dit qu'elle s'éloigne, ça veut dire que la cible est en-dessous de la droite orange, elle est très loin de C, et le prochain saut va apporter encore très peu d'informations. Et si on lui dit qu'elle s'éloigne, certes la zone restante est très grande (au dessus de la droite orange), mais on devrait pouvoir débroussailler vite.
Supposons que la cible est au dessus de cette droite orange.
Le saut suivant sera en D (-4,14) environ.
On va lui dire que la cible est au-dessus ou en-dessous de la droite verte. Si la cible est en-dessus de la droite verte, et si elle est proche du point D, dans ce petit triangle, la puce va mettre beaucoup de temps avant de trouver la cible.
Donc on va rectifier le point D, pour que ce petit triangle disparaisse.

etc

Saut de puce savante

Posté par
Vassillia
re : Saut de puce savante 19-11-22 à 13:13

Il suffit de la trouver et on considère que c'est gagné

Posté par
ty59847
re : Saut de puce savante 19-11-22 à 13:14

Faute de frappe au début, c'est 10 sauts max et non 18.

Posté par
ty59847
re : Saut de puce savante 19-11-22 à 15:45

Quand la puce saute en C, si on lui dit qu'elle s'éloigne, elle va sauter en D2, puis en F2.
Et là, elle voit forcément la cible, puisque la cible est dans la zone colorée en bleu, et que le cercle de centre F2 couvre largement cette zone.
On peut donc déplacer un peu le point C, le mettre proche de (2.7,6.8) au lieu de (2,6)

Saut de puce savante

Posté par
ty59847
re : Saut de puce savante 19-11-22 à 16:16

Après le saut en D, si on apprend que la cible est au-dessus de la droite verte, on saute en F4 puis G4, et forcément, on voit la cible.
Si on apprend que la cible est en dessous de la droite verte, on saute en F3 puis G3, et on voit la cible, sauf si elle est dans la toute petite zone jaune en bas.
Donc on s'aperçoit que la stratégie n'est pas optimale. Le chemin B,C,D2,F2 nous permettait de voir la cible en 4 sauts si la cible était sous la ligne orange.
Et il nous faut 6 sauts quand la cible est dans la toute petite zone jaune.
On peut certainement équilibrer un peu mieux, et s'assurer de voir la cible dans tous les cas après 5 sauts.
Restera aussi à vérifier que si la cible est à droite de la verticale rouge, on est sûr de la voir en 5 sauts.

Saut de puce savante

Posté par
carpediem
re : Saut de puce savante 19-11-22 à 16:32

bon je viens de me rendre compte en regardant les réponses précédentes que j'ai oublié l'info "champ de vision" !!

ty59847

Posté par
Imod
re : Saut de puce savante 19-11-22 à 17:00

Bonjour

Un dessin qui peut peut-être aider :

Saut de puce savante
Imod

Posté par
ty59847
re : Saut de puce savante 19-11-22 à 17:56

Après quelques vérifications, en déplaçant le point C vers (4.28, 8.21), la puce est assurée de voir la cible après 3 autres sauts maximum, et donc atteindre la cible en 7 sauts maximum en tout.

Et si le premier saut a été positif (la puce s'approche de la cible), alors idem, on arrive très vite à la cible.

Posté par
Vassillia
re : Saut de puce savante 20-11-22 à 17:14

Bravo ty59847 tu as optimisé au mieux !



Vous devez être membre accéder à ce service...

Pas encore inscrit ?

1 compte par personne, multi-compte interdit !

Ou identifiez-vous :


Rester sur la page

Désolé, votre version d'Internet Explorer est plus que périmée ! Merci de le mettre à jour ou de télécharger Firefox ou Google Chrome pour utiliser le site. Votre ordinateur vous remerciera !